在全球化浪潮的推动下,越来越多的企业选择出海拓展业务。然而,出海不仅意味着市场扩展,还伴随着复杂的技术挑战。尤其是在运维领域,企业需要面对跨国网络环境、多语言用户支持、高并发请求处理等难题。传统的运维方式已难以满足现代企业的需求,智能运维(AIOps,Artificial Intelligence for Operations)逐渐成为出海企业的首选解决方案。
本文将深入探讨基于AIOps的全链路监控与自动化解决方案,帮助企业更好地应对出海过程中的运维挑战。
什么是AIOps?
AIOps是人工智能与运维(Operations)的结合,旨在通过AI技术提升运维效率、降低故障率并优化用户体验。与传统运维相比,AIOps具有以下特点:
- 智能化:通过机器学习和大数据分析,AIOps能够自动识别问题、预测故障并提供解决方案。
- 自动化:AIOps可以实现运维流程的自动化,减少人工干预,提高运维效率。
- 全链路监控:AIOps能够覆盖从开发到生产的全生命周期,实时监控系统运行状态,确保端到端的性能优化。
对于出海企业而言,AIOps不仅能够提升运维效率,还能帮助企业在跨国环境中快速响应问题,保障业务的连续性和稳定性。
出海智能运维的核心需求
在出海过程中,企业面临以下运维挑战:
- 跨国网络环境:不同国家的网络环境差异大,可能导致延迟、丢包等问题。
- 多语言支持:需要实时监控多语言用户的行为,确保服务质量。
- 高并发处理:出海企业通常面临全球用户访问,系统需要处理高并发请求。
- 法律法规 compliance:不同国家的法律法规对数据存储和传输有严格要求,需要实时监控以确保合规性。
基于这些需求,AIOps能够提供以下解决方案:
- 全链路监控:实时监控应用、网络、数据库等关键指标,快速定位问题。
- 自动化故障修复:通过AI算法预测故障并自动触发修复流程。
- 智能流量调度:根据用户地理位置和网络状况,智能分配最优资源。
- 数据可视化:通过数字孪生和数字可视化技术,将运维数据以直观的方式呈现,便于决策者快速理解。
基于AIOps的全链路监控解决方案
1. 应用性能监控(APM)
应用性能监控是智能运维的核心模块之一。通过AIOps,企业可以实时监控应用程序的性能指标,包括响应时间、错误率、吞吐量等。当系统出现异常时,AIOps能够快速定位问题并提供修复建议。
关键功能:
- 实时监控:支持多维度指标监控,包括CPU、内存、磁盘IO等。
- 智能告警:基于历史数据和机器学习算法,自动设置告警阈值。
- 调用链分析:通过链路追踪技术,快速定位问题根源。
应用场景:
- 高并发场景下的性能优化。
- 全球用户访问时的延迟优化。
2. 网络监控
出海企业需要面对复杂的网络环境,网络监控是保障业务稳定性的关键。AIOps可以通过以下方式实现网络监控:
关键功能:
- 网络流量分析:实时监控网络带宽、延迟、丢包率等指标。
- 智能路由优化:根据网络状况动态调整路由策略,确保用户访问速度最优。
- 安全监控:实时检测网络攻击和异常流量,保障网络安全。
应用场景:
3. 数据库监控
数据库是企业业务的核心,其性能直接影响用户体验。AIOps可以通过以下方式实现数据库监控:
关键功能:
- SQL语句分析:通过机器学习算法优化SQL执行效率。
- 数据库性能预测:基于历史数据预测未来性能趋势,提前采取优化措施。
- 自动化备份与恢复:确保数据库数据的安全性和可用性。
应用场景:
基于AIOps的自动化解决方案
1. 自动化故障修复
AIOps的核心价值之一是自动化故障修复。通过机器学习和大数据分析,AIOps能够快速识别问题并自动触发修复流程。
工作原理:
- 数据采集:通过监控工具实时采集系统运行数据。
- 数据分析:利用机器学习算法分析数据,识别异常模式。
- 自动修复:根据分析结果,自动执行修复操作,如重启服务、调整配置等。
优势:
- 减少人工干预,降低运维成本。
- 提高故障响应速度,保障业务连续性。
2. 自动化部署与扩展
在出海过程中,企业需要频繁部署新功能并扩展资源。AIOps可以通过以下方式实现自动化部署与扩展:
关键功能:
- CI/CD:通过持续集成和持续部署技术,实现代码的自动化测试和发布。
- 自动化扩缩容:根据系统负载自动调整资源规模,确保性能最优。
应用场景:
- 高并发场景下的资源弹性扩展。
- 新功能的快速迭代与发布。
数据中台与数字孪生在智能运维中的应用
1. 数据中台
数据中台是智能运维的重要支撑。通过数据中台,企业可以将分散在各个系统中的数据进行整合、清洗和分析,为AIOps提供高质量的数据支持。
关键功能:
- 数据集成:支持多种数据源的接入,包括数据库、日志、监控数据等。
- 数据处理:通过ETL(Extract, Transform, Load)技术对数据进行清洗和转换。
- 数据分析:利用大数据技术对数据进行深度分析,提取有价值的信息。
优势:
- 提高数据利用率,为智能运维提供数据支持。
- 降低数据孤岛现象,提升企业数据资产的价值。
2. 数字孪生
数字孪生是近年来兴起的一项技术,通过创建物理世界的数字模型,实现对系统的实时监控和优化。在智能运维中,数字孪生可以用于以下场景:
关键功能:
- 系统模拟:通过数字模型模拟系统运行状态,预测未来性能。
- 实时监控:将物理系统与数字模型进行实时同步,实现可视化监控。
- 优化建议:基于数字模型分析,提供系统优化建议。
应用场景:
数字可视化:让运维更直观
数字可视化是智能运维的重要组成部分,通过将运维数据以直观的方式呈现,帮助运维人员快速理解系统状态。
关键功能:
- 数据可视化:通过图表、仪表盘等方式展示运维数据。
- 用户交互:支持用户与数字模型进行交互,实现对系统的实时控制。
- 可视化分析:通过数据可视化技术,快速识别问题并提供解决方案。
优势:
- 提高运维效率,降低学习成本。
- 便于团队协作,提升运维团队的整体能力。
出海智能运维的未来趋势
随着技术的不断进步,出海智能运维将朝着以下几个方向发展:
- 更强大的AI能力:通过深度学习和自然语言处理技术,AIOps将具备更强的智能决策能力。
- 更全面的自动化:AIOps将实现运维流程的全面自动化,进一步降低人工干预。
- 更广泛的应用场景:AIOps将被应用于更多的业务场景,如边缘计算、物联网等。
结语
出海智能运维是企业在全球化竞争中不可或缺的能力。通过基于AIOps的全链路监控与自动化解决方案,企业可以显著提升运维效率、降低故障率并优化用户体验。如果您对AIOps感兴趣,不妨申请试用相关工具,体验智能运维的魅力。
申请试用
申请试用&下载资料
点击袋鼠云官网申请免费试用:
https://www.dtstack.com/?src=bbs
点击袋鼠云资料中心免费下载干货资料:
https://www.dtstack.com/resources/?src=bbs
《数据资产管理白皮书》下载地址:
https://www.dtstack.com/resources/1073/?src=bbs
《行业指标体系白皮书》下载地址:
https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:
https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:
https://www.dtstack.com/resources/1004/?src=bbs
免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。